Games expected to leave PS Plus Extra and Premium in September 2026
As a reminder, games tend to leave the service after 12 months and/or 24 months. Occasionally, you’ll see games leaving PS Plus after six months, too. This article contains predictions based on this pattern and is meant to give our readers a heads-up.
With that said, here are the games that were added to the service in September 2024 and are still in the catalog: Under the Waves, Chernobylite Complete Edition, Space Engineers, and Ben 10. Far Cry 5 also remains in the catalog but is unlikely to leave due to Ubisoft+.
As for games added a year ago, besides Persona 5 Tactica, here are the titles still available in the catalog: Green Hell, Fate/Samurai Remnant, Crow Country, The Invicible, and Conscript.
